                    Periphonics Stockholders Approve
                Acquisition of Periphonics by Nortel Networks

BRAMPTON, Ontario and NEW YORK - Nortel Networks (NYSE/TSE:NT) and Periphonics
Corporation (NASDAQ:PERI) announced today that the acquisition of Periphonics by
Nortel Networks was approved by the Periphonics stockholders at the annual
meeting of stockholders held this morning in Hauppauge, New York.

The acquisition will be effected by the merger of a wholly-owned subsidiary of
Nortel Networks with and into Periphonics. Nortel Networks and Periphonics
expect that the merger will close on Friday, November 12, 1999.

On August 24, 1999, Nortel Networks and Periphonics announced the entering into
of a definitive merger agreement, whereby Nortel Networks will acquire
Periphonics. Nortel Networks and Periphonics announced the early termination of
the waiting period under the Hart-Scott-Rodino Antitrust Improvements Act of
1976 on October 6, 1999, and announced the clearance of the German Act Against
Restraints on Competition by the German Federal Cartel Office on October 27,
1999.

Periphonics Corporation is a global leader in the development, marketing and
support of products and professional services for Computer Telephony Integration
(CTI) and Telecom Enhanced Network Services. Periphonics' products and services
utilize such technologies as Interactive Voice Response (IVR), advanced speech
processing with large vocabulary recognition, natural language processing and
text-to-speech, as well as interactive processing via Web browsers, messaging,
and fax. Periphonics' products and professional services help its customers
enhance their customer service offerings, increase caller satisfaction, reduce
operating costs and create new revenue opportunities. Periphonics is an ISO
9001/TickIT registered company with systems installed in more than 50 countries.

Periphonics Corporation's common shares are quoted on the NASDAQ Stock Market
and had fiscal year 1999 revenues of US$142.3 million and has approximately 900
employees worldwide.

Nortel Networks is a global leader in telephony, data, wireless and wireline
solutions for the Internet. The Company had 1998 revenues of US$17.6 billion and
serves carrier, service provider and enterprise customers globally. Today,
Nortel Networks is creating a high-performance Internet that is more reliable
and faster than ever before. It is redefining the economics and quality of
networking and the Internet through Unified Networks* that promise a new era of
collaboration, communications and commerce.
